Why and When You Should Hire Workmans Comp Lawyers in Chicago?

If you’re involved in the route of filing your workers’ compensation claim, you may think that under such circumstances an employer and employee work in conjunction to get to an agreement regarding your claim or in determining the possible compensation, however, there are a number of circumstances where employer and employee cannot meet to an agreement regarding the injury or on compensation amount.

Why Do You Need

Hiring is Affordable - In general, the cost of Workmans lawyers in Chicago is not so expensive. Most importantly, if the cost issue holds you back, don’t panic. Most workers’ compensation attorneys represent you on a contingency basis; and therefore, you’re not obligated to pay your lawyer if the attorney cannot help you get compensated.

Protect Your Legal Right - Being an injured worker, you’ve certain legal rights. However, the insurance company or your employer may not inform you of those rights. This is a very common experience which may deprive you of having your legitimate compensation.

Sort Out Possible Issues - While many Workmans compensation claims tend to be an easy-going process, there’re plenty of cases that face varieties of obstacles. Considering the chance, you should be prepared once the issue arises since there is a time limit before which you should advance to a lawsuit and simply cannot pass your days, weeks, or months being without pay. Thereby when you are accompanied by Workmans comp lawyers in Chicago, you have an expert with you to resolve such issues as soon as possible.

Knowledge About the Law - With years of experience in handling workers’ compensation claims, they are well-informed about the law, its legal procedures as well as how to deal with insurance companies when an issue crops up.

Receipt of Hassle-Free Compensation - There is no denying that being severely injured, you are expected to focus on your healing session and not for learning the laws concerning workers’ rights or negotiating with the insurance company or the employer. With an attorney beside, you don’t have to take any hassle for negotiating or arguing since they take care of the issues related to your claim.

When Do You Need

By and large, under the following circumstance, you should contact Workmans comp lawyers in Chicago to represent on your behalf

Your Claim Has Been Denied - This is typically the case whereas an employer challenges whether or not the worker was present in the workplace, and thereby denies the claim. There may be different causes of denying your claim.

Your Long-Term Disability is in Question - If you’re diagnosed with a long-term disability by a physician, it could be challenged by your employer. And they may ask you to meet a doctor out of their choice.

Having a Pre-Existing Condition - If you encounter an injury with a specific part of your body which was injured previously, or become a victim of critical disease like lung/ skin cancer (mainly caused by exposure to asbestos in industries like building construction, electricity or power supply related industries, electronics, paints and more an insurance company may disqualify your case while claiming as it has been caused by your preexisting health condition.

Paying You Lowest Possible Compensation - By nature, insurance companies are aiming at paying you the lowest possible compensation or settlement money. They have a common tendency to enter into legal proceedings that typically continue for a long time involving a lot of money and time and thereby force workers to have the lowest settlement money than what they actually deserve. This often brings worry as well as controversy among employees and employers.
